Weight, color and texture of Whale ivories is really not so difficult to tell from substances poured into casts. The base is a sure way to tell--Ivory grows in annular rings, or depending upon how a piece of ivory tooth is cut or shaped, it may appear to be layered. When polished and lighted from one side or angle, it should show internal texturing of color to even a minute degree. Ivory is in thin layers and near thin or sharp corners, slightly translucent.
Do not expect to find very many actual whaling artifacts out there on the market. Honestly, there are more fake whale tooth carvings than there ever were whales themselves.
Reproduction-pieces should be valued at no more than $25-$75, and original carvings are considerably more valuable.
If unsure still, do a Google search of the ship or theme or writing on the piece, in a search starting with 'Whaling Ivory' followed by your available data.
Many pieces are replicas of actual ivories....if this is so, you can usually look at images of the original.
